PHP(Hypertext Preprocessor,超文本预处理器)是一种广泛应用的开源脚本语言,主要用于Web开发,PHP具有跨平台性、高性能、易学易用等特点,使其成为众多开发者的首选编程语言,通过PHP,开发者可以轻松构建动态网站、Web应用、内容管理系统等,以下是关于PHP可以从事的岗位以及相关领域的介绍。
1、Web开发工程师:Web开发工程师是PHP应用最为广泛的岗位之一,他们负责设计、开发和维护网站和Web应用程序,通过PHP,开发人员可以快速构建功能丰富、响应式强的网站,满足各种业务需求,PHP还可以与其他编程语言和技术(如HTML、CSS、JavaScript等)相结合,实现更为复杂的Web项目。
2、后端开发工程师:后端开发工程师主要负责服务器端的程序开发工作,包括数据库设计、API开发、服务器配置等,PHP作为一种功能强大的服务器端编程语言,可以轻松处理各种后端任务,如数据存储、用户身份验证、服务器与客户端之间的通信等。
3、内容管理系统(CMS)开发者:内容管理系统是用于创建、发布和管理网站内容的软件,PHP是许多流行CMS(如WordPress、Drupal、Joomla等)的基础语言,作为CMS开发者,可以利用PHP为各种行业和需求定制内容管理系统,提高网站运营效率。
4、电子商务平台开发者:电子商务平台是在线购物和交易的核心,PHP可以用于开发功能完善的电子商务平台,如在线购物车、支付网关集成、订单管理等,通过PHP,开发者可以为企业打造定制化的电子商务解决方案,满足不同规模和类型的商业需求。
常见问题与解答:
Q1: 学习PHP需要具备哪些基础知识?
A1: 学习PHP之前,建议具备基本的计算机操作能力和编程思维,了解HTML、CSS等前端技术会对学习PHP有所帮助,但不是必须,学习数据库基础知识(如MySQL)也是非常重要的,因为PHP经常与数据库进行交互。
Q2: PHP有哪些主流框架?
A2: PHP有许多优秀的框架,可以帮助开发者提高开发效率和代码质量,一些主流的PHP框架包括Laravel、Symfony、CodeIgniter、Yii等,不同的框架具有不同的特点和优势,开发者可以根据项目需求和个人喜好选择合适的框架。
Q3: PHP的发展前景如何?
A3: 尽管近年来出现了许多新的编程语言和框架,但PHP依然保持着广泛的应用和活跃的社区支持,PHP不断更新和优化,以适应不断变化的Web开发需求,从事PHP相关工作仍具有较好的发展前景,掌握PHP也为学习其他编程语言和技术打下了良好的基础。